Students Turn Business Skills into Community Impact with R.I.S.E

On January 13, 2026, BTBOCES_New Visions Academy (Vestal) students RJ Matthews (CEO of the team), Ava Meza, and Nathan Purdy, along with students from other area school districts, presented their student-run business, R.I.S.E., during their final business presentation. Local business leaders, family members, community members, and superintendents were in attendance.
Throughout the school year students worked together on their company, from developing the business model to marketing and selling their product, the R.I.S.E. Essentials Kit. This kit was created to solve a common problem: everyday items you need but can't find in one place. (Wet wipes, stain remover, hand sanitizer, tissues, lint roller and mints.) The team built strong financial skills through real-world application.
R.I.S.E. set a new record, as the most successful company in New Visions Business Academy history, raising over $7,000! All the proceeds were donated to local charities, including Angel Tree shopping and supporting families in our community.
